Output 18ad88faa4618425e6a18593b63070348d9e12995141e923d044969b4dbe8a61:15

value
3812500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512f07ab71be074e23d758bd2bf46a280cffeb5b OP_EQUAL
address
9yqXjdK8fA5FapU6STAzEwhowaSktsFE4V
transaction
18ad88faa4618425e6a18593b63070348d9e12995141e923d044969b4dbe8a61